Description
Citrinin is a mycotoxin produced primarily by fungi of the genera Penicillium , Aspergillus , or Monascus . It is frequently found in foodstuffs stored under poor conditions, particularly cereals, grains, fermented red rice, or yeast-based food supplements.
Known for its kidney toxicity, this natural contaminant is subject to strict control in many countries, particularly in Asia and Europe. Citrinin levels can be used to assess the safety of products intended for human and animal consumption, as well as to verify the regulatory compliance of fermented nutraceutical or functional ingredients.

Proposed analytical method
Citrinin analysis is performed by liquid chromatography coupled with tandem mass spectrometry (LC-MS/MS), a reference method for detecting trace mycotoxins in complex matrices. This technique offers excellent sensitivity, specificity, and reproducibility.
In case of specific needs or low content samples, pre-concentration of the sample and purification steps can be offered (SPE, immunoaffinity).
